JavaScript is not enabled.
No Windows - Review by Guest | Windowizards

Windowizards

Claim

No Windows 1/12/2011

Gave a down payment in September and received no windows, received a phone call after the news ran that Window Wizard was out of business to tell me that they were going to still install my windows and they would install them in December 23, 2010 after the date I called every am and pm and received the same message. And still today I have not heard from any one. more
Summer SALE!!!:
15% OFF all yearly plans
Use year15 at checkout. Expires 1/1/2021